    Taking stills while watching avi files

    I was watching pinky and the brain and thought thats a good shot, but then i realised i don't know how to get a still of it, obviously print screen won't work, does anyone else know how to? or what program to use that will do it?

    That's because the overlay.

    You need to turn it off. Or go into your system settings and turn your graphic accelleration to low.
